The faithful celebrated the Feast of Presentation of our Lord to the Temple in the courtyard of the Holy Mother of God Church in Nork Marash
Members of the "Masunk" traditional song and dance ensemble sang songs dedicated to the Presentation of our Lord to the Temple around a bonfire in the courtyard of the Holy Mother of God Church in Nork Marash. Members of the church's youth union are also in this ensemble. The ensemble members held a master class in national songs and dances, making those present participate in the celebration.

The premiere of the composition "Graceful, Prayerful" took place at the Armenian Composers' Art FestivalVache Sharafyan has dedicated a new composition to the 850th anniversary of the death of Saint Nerses the Graceful, Patriarch of All Armenians and the reconsecration of the Mother Cathedral. The premiere of the composition “Merciful, Prayerful” marked the beginning of the 16th Festival of Armenian Compositional Art. It was organized by the State Symphony Orchestra with the aim of popularizing the works of Armenian classical and contemporary composers. Within the framework of the festival, the works are recorded, videotaped, and the scores are digitized and preserved. |

FAR supports forcibly displaced Artsakh residents living in border settlements of TavushThe Armenian Relief Fund of the Armenian Apostolic Church is implementing the “Support for Displaced Persons from Nagorno-Karabakh and Host Rural Communities” program for the displaced from Artsakh with the funding of the German Federal Foreign Office. It started in September and will continue until next September. Under the program, about 500 families from Artsakh and local communities living in the communities of Tavush region have been provided with firewood in advance of winter. Every month, families are provided with hygiene items, and soon household appliances and accessories, dishes, and linen. Psychological support is provided to overcome the trauma of war, blockade, and forced displacement. |

After Christmas, clergy perform a house blessing ceremonyTo proclaim the good news and distribute blessings, priests visit the homes of believers, bless the goods of the house and family members. According to the testimony of the evangelists, the ceremony of blessing the house was established by Jesus Christ, commanding his disciples to wish peace in that house when entering it. From the first century, the apostles visited the homes of believers to proclaim the good news of the Nativity and the Glorious Resurrection and distribute blessings. This spiritual and pious ceremony is continued by the Holy Apostolic Church to this day through the blessing of the house. |

American-based national philanthropist Sargis Bedevyan has diedHe assisted in the establishment of the Vazgenyan Seminary in Sevan. He sponsored the construction of a comprehensive school in Gyumri. With his philanthropy, the Mother Church of St. Gregory of Narek was built in Vanadzor, and 3 years after its consecration, the Armenian Children's Home was put into operation. The Khrimyan Museum-Gallery, located in the southwestern part of the old monastery, built by Catholicos Mkrtich Khrimyan in 1896, was renovated with the philanthropy of Sargis and Ruth Bedevyan. The Bedevyan family contributed to the renovation of the Mother Cathedral of Etchmiadzin. |

Ashtarak Youth Center duduk players won first place in the "World Art Games" competition
Participating in the “World Art Games” international competition held remotely in Spain, the duduk players of the Ashtarak Youth Center were awarded the honorary “First” prize. There is a duduk class at the Ashtarak Gulameryan Youth Center of the Mother See of Holy Etchmiadzin. The education is for 5 years. The duduk class already has graduates who have been admitted to music colleges.
